comp.lang.ada
 help / color / mirror / Atom feed
From: "Björn Lundin" <b.f.lundin@gmail.com>
Subject: Re: Ada for Automation
Date: Tue, 18 Nov 2014 09:52:13 +0100
Date: 2014-11-18T09:52:13+01:00	[thread overview]
Message-ID: <m4f190$hhq$1@dont-email.me> (raw)
In-Reply-To: <3e877e3f-c9ad-48a5-941d-08a7f5c3f317@googlegroups.com>

On 2014-11-06 12:14, slos wrote:
> Hello,
> 
> "Ada for Automation" (A4A in short) is a framework, for designing
> industrial automation applications using the Ada language.
> It uses the libmodbus library to allow building a Modbus TCP client or
server,
> or a Modbus RTU master. It can also use Hilscher communication boards
allowing to
>communicate on field buses like AS-Interface, CANopen, CC-Link,
DeviceNet, PROFIBUS,
> EtherCAT, Ethernet/IP, Modbus TCP, PROFINET, Sercos III, POWERLINK, or
VARAN.
> 

This seems good for writing PLC logic with, for conveyor systems,
stacker cranes, etc for warehouse automation, which is my field of work.

I see others has criticized the project for high latency, eg ns needed
in measuring processes within combustion engines, but in my kind of
automation ms is good enough.

Unfortuantly, the PLC level is nowadays programmed by the vendors of the
machinery. In the 80's and 90's the ancestor of my present day company
did not only WMS/WCS (Warehouse Management Systems/Warehouse Control
Systems) control but also on-board steering software of stacker cranes
and AGVs.

However those days are long gone, since the hardware vendors learned to
do that themselves, leaving us with WMS/WCS. And we _usually_ speak some
serial protocol, or now more commonly some TCP/IP protocol.

Very few sites use OPC, which was believed to be THE way of
communicating in the early 2000s

Talking modbus directly would be nice, but in my field, I don't see
any of the vendors preferring that to TCP/IP.

But If I was given the opportunity to do conveyor system logic
in say a raspberry pi, I'd definitely would look closer to you project.

Much closer.
I see it as an asset.
Good luck

--
Björn

  parent reply	other threads:[~2014-11-18  8:52 UTC|newest]

Thread overview: 21+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2014-11-06 11:14 Ada for Automation slos
2014-11-06 13:31 ` Dmitry A. Kazakov
2014-11-06 14:43   ` slos
2014-11-06 17:22     ` Dmitry A. Kazakov
2014-11-06 21:58       ` slos
2014-11-07  8:29         ` Dmitry A. Kazakov
2014-11-07  9:51           ` slos
2014-11-07 13:44             ` Dmitry A. Kazakov
2014-11-07 15:23               ` slos
2014-11-07 17:16                 ` Dmitry A. Kazakov
2014-11-07 20:37                   ` slos
2014-11-07 21:15                     ` Dmitry A. Kazakov
2014-11-07 22:21                       ` slos
2014-11-07 11:44           ` slos
2014-11-07 13:46             ` Dmitry A. Kazakov
2014-11-18  8:52 ` Björn Lundin [this message]
2014-11-18  9:28   ` Dmitry A. Kazakov
2014-11-18 10:43     ` Björn Lundin
2014-11-18 11:03       ` Dmitry A. Kazakov
2014-11-18 12:27         ` Björn Lundin
2014-11-18 13:24           ` Dmitry A. Kazakov
replies disabled

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ox